China Petroleum & Chemical Corp. engages in oil and gas and chemical business. The oil and gas business includes exploration, development and production of crude oil and natural gas; pipeline crude oil and natural gas; refining crude oil into petroleum products; and marketing crude oil, natural gas, and refined oil. The chemical business includes the manufacture and marketing of a wide range of industrial chemical products. The company was founded on February 25, 2000 and is headquartered in Beijing, China.
